Transaction 812cc7584714f562762349b73095e4c09764208688abe4465f2516bfa86d7b91
1 Input
2 Outputs
- 812cc7584714f562762349b73095e4c09764208688abe4465f2516bfa86d7b91:0
- 812cc7584714f562762349b73095e4c09764208688abe4465f2516bfa86d7b91:1
value 11156944
address 18XLawbtEkYM74AhBoCYLBKGgxhAgc8qFR
value 5812966
address 1PTkRAFCqkCPw6mqjd28nvZkQpMmt2vw3M